Local Transformation Plans
Berkshire CAMHS are working closely with both NHS East Berkshire Clinical Commissioning Group and NHS West Berkshire Clinical Commissioning Group who are leading on work across Berkshire to improve and transform mental health services for children and young people.
This work has been developed as part of a national programme, following recognition that children’s emotional wellbeing and mental health has for many years been an area which has not been given sufficiently priority and funding.
Both Clinical Commissioning Groups have published local transformation plans outlining what we are doing and what we want to do together to better support children and young people’s emotional health and wellbeing, including CAMHS.
